What is the summary of Snegurochka?

Snegurochka of Russian Fairy Tales

This Snegurochka is the daughter of Spring and Winter who appears to a childless couple as a winter blessing. Unable or forbidden to love, Snegurochka remains indoors with her human parents until the pull of the outdoors and the urge to be with her peers becomes unbearable.

What are the origins of Snegurochka?

Nevertheless, Snegurochka's origins appear to lie in the German Schneekind—a snow child created out of an old couple's longing, the pagan daughter of winter who melts in the spring.

What is the ending of Snegurochka?

Just then, the morning mist is pierced by a ray of sunlight which falls on Snegurochka. Knowing now that her end is near, she thanks her mother for giving her the gift of love. The snow maiden melts away, and Mizgir, in despair, drowns himself in the lake.

Is Morozko a God?

1. Unholy origins: Centuries ago, Ded Moroz went by the name Morozko, a powerful and cruel god of frost and ice, married to the equally unforgiving Winter. He could freeze people and landscapes at will, including entire invading armies.

What is the original ending of Snow White?

3. Snow White. At the end of the original German version penned by the brothers Grimm, the wicked queen is fatally punished for trying to kill Snow White. It's the method she is punished by that is so strange "“ she is made to dance wearing a pair of red-hot iron shoes until she falls over dead.

What is the real dark story of Snow White?

There has also been the suggestion that the story of Snow White originated from the real-life story of a countess and her alleged lover, Philip II of Spain. The countess, named Margarete von Waldeck (1553 – 1554) was supposedly poisoned at a young age, as politics were more important than real love at the time.
